Form Details

Fact Name Description
Purpose The Washington RV Bill of Sale form is used to document the sale and transfer of ownership of a recreational vehicle (RV) from the seller to the buyer within the state of Washington.
Requirements It must include the date of the sale, the names and addresses of the buyer and seller, a description of the RV (including make, model, year, and VIN), and the purchase price.
Governing Law The form is governed by Washington state laws applicable to the sale of motor vehicles, including Chapter 46.12 RCW which pertains to vehicle certificates of ownership and registration.
Additional Considerations Both the buyer and seller should keep a copy of the completed form for their records. It may be required for registration purposes and to settle any disputes that might arise in the future regarding the transaction.

Steps to Filling Out Washington RV Bill of Sale

Filling out a Bill of Sale for an RV in Washington State marks a crucial step in the process of buying or selling a recreational vehicle. This document serves as a legal record of the transaction, detailing the parties involved, the RV being sold, and the terms of the sale. It helps to establish the transfer of ownership and can be a key piece of evidence in case of disputes or for tax purposes. To ensure accuracy and compliance with Washington State regulations, follow these steps closely when completing the RV Bill of Sale form.

  1. Start by entering the date of the sale at the top of the form. This should reflect the exact day the transaction is finalized.
  2. Next, write the full names and addresses of the seller and the buyer. Make sure to include any middle initials and avoid nicknames to ensure the form’s professionalism and readability.
  3. Describe the RV in detail in the designated section. Include the make, model, year, color, vehicle identification number (VIN), and any other identifying features. This helps in identifying the specific RV involved in the transaction and distinguishes it from others.
  4. Enter the sale price of the RV. This should be the agreed amount between the buyer and seller. If the RV is a gift, indicate a fair market value for record-keeping purposes.
  5. Specify the terms of the sale. This includes any conditions such as “as is” to indicate that the RV is being sold in its current condition, or any warranties provided by the seller.
  6. Both the seller and the buyer must sign and print their names at the bottom of the form. This acts as a formal agreement to the terms of the sale and acknowledges the transfer of ownership.
  7. Date the signatures. Both parties should write the date next to their signatures to indicate when they officially entered into the agreement.

Once completed, both the buyer and the seller should keep a copy of the RV Bill of Sale for their records. This document not only finalizes the sale but also serves as a valuable reference for future needs, such as registration and tax purposes. Remember, it's important to review all entries for accuracy and completeness before finalizing the document to ensure a smooth and legally sound transaction.

Dos and Don'ts

When engaging in the sale of a recreational vehicle (RV) in Washington, the Bill of Sale form is a crucial document that records the transaction, providing legal protection for both the buyer and the seller. Completing this form accurately is important to ensure that the sale complies with state laws and regulations, and to protect both parties in the event of future disputes. Here are key dos and don'ts to consider when filling out the Washington RV Bill of Sale form:

  • Do ensure all the information provided is accurate and complete. This includes the names and addresses of both the buyer and the seller, along with the specific details of the RV, such as make, model, year, and Vehicle Identification Number (VIN).
  • Do verify the correct form is being used. Since regulations can vary from one jurisdiction to another within the state, it’s essential to make sure the Bill of Sale is the appropriate version for the area where the transaction is taking place.
  • Do include the sale price and the date of the transaction. This information is critical for tax purposes and for establishing the legal transfer of ownership.
  • Do ensure that both the buyer and the seller sign the document. Their signatures are needed to validate the Bill of Sale and certify that both parties agree to the terms and conditions of the sale.
  • Don’t forget to check for any additional requirements specific to Washington. Some areas may require the Bill of Sale to be notarized or accompanied by other documentation, such as an odometer reading.
  • Don’t omit any outstanding liens or encumbrances on the RV. Transparency about the vehicle's financial and legal status is necessary to provide a clear transfer of ownership.
  • Don’t fill out the form in haste. Take the time to review all entries for correctness and ensure that nothing has been overlooked. Mistakes or omissions can lead to legal complications down the road.
  • Don’t fail to provide both parties with a copy of the completed Bill of Sale. Keeping a record of the transaction is important for both legal protection and personal record-keeping.

By following these guidelines, sellers and buyers can create a solid and legally binding document that clearly outlines the terms of the RV sale, ensuring a smoother transaction and minimizing potential disputes in the future.
